A Robust Method for Registration and Segmentation of Multiple Range Images

Registration and segmentation of multiple range images are important problems in range image analysis. We propose a new algorithm of range data registration and segmentation that is robust in the presence of outlying points (outliers) like noise and occlusion. The registration algorithm determines rigid motion parameters from a pair of range images. Our method is an integration of the iterative closest point (ICP) algorithm with random sampling and least median of squares (LMS or LMedS) estimator. The segmentation method classifies the input data points into four categories comprising inliers and 3 types of outliers. Finally, we integrate the inliers obtained from multiple range images to construct a data set representing an entire object. We have experimented with our method both on synthetic range images and on real range images taken by two kinds of rangefinders. The proposed method does not need preliminary processes such as smoothing or trimming of isolated points because of its robustness. It also offers the advantage of reducing the computational cost.

[1]  Peter J. Rousseeuw,et al.  Robust regression and outlier detection , 1987 .

[2]  Berthold K. P. Horn,et al.  Closed-form solution of absolute orientation using unit quaternions , 1987 .

[3]  John G. Harris,et al.  Rigid body motion from range image sequences , 1991, CVGIP Image Underst..

[4]  M. Hebert,et al.  The Representation, Recognition, and Locating of 3-D Objects , 1986 .

[5]  Kenichi Kanatani,et al.  Geometric computation for machine vision , 1993 .

[6]  N. Yokoya,et al.  A robust method for registration and segmentation of multiple range images , 1994, Proceedings of 1994 IEEE 2nd CAD-Based Vision Workshop.

[7]  Nasser Kehtarnavaz,et al.  A framework for estimation of motion parameters from range images , 1989, Comput. Vis. Graph. Image Process..

[8]  Jake K. Aggarwal,et al.  Estimation of motion from a pair of range images: A review , 1991, CVGIP Image Underst..

[9]  Marc Rioux,et al.  Direct estimation of deformable motion parameters from range image sequence , 1990, [1990] Proceedings Third International Conference on Computer Vision.

[10]  Francois Blais,et al.  Range imaging sensors development at NRC Laboratories , 1989, [1989] Proceedings. Workshop on Interpretation of 3D Scenes.

[11]  Paul J. Besl,et al.  A Method for Registration of 3-D Shapes , 1992, IEEE Trans. Pattern Anal. Mach. Intell..

[12]  Yoshihiro Kawai,et al.  Reconstruction of 3D objects by integration of multiple range data , 1992, [1992] Proceedings. 11th IAPR International Conference on Pattern Recognition.

[13]  Takashi Yoshimi,et al.  Multi Light Sources Range Finder System , 1991, MVA.

[14]  Martin D. Levine,et al.  Minimal Subset Random Sampling for Pose Determination and Refinement , 1992, Advances in Machine Vision.